Select the Right Karaoke Bar
Not all karaoke bars offer the same experience. Some concentrate on lively open-mic performances in front of a crowd, while others provide private rooms for smaller groups. Earlier than making plans, check what type of karaoke bar fits your mood and group size. If you need a fun and energetic public atmosphere, a stage-style venue may be perfect. In the event you prefer a more relaxed and private setting, a room-based karaoke lounge is usually the higher choice.
It is usually smart to look at on-line reviews, photos, pricing, and reservation options. Some karaoke bars are known for better sound systems, larger tune libraries, or stronger food and drink menus. Choosing the proper location can make a major distinction in your general experience.
Check the Reservation Policy
Many popular karaoke bars get busy, particularly on weekends and holidays. One of the crucial essential items on any karaoke bar checklist is confirming whether or not you want a reservation. Private karaoke rooms typically require advance booking, and some venues may have minimal spending requirements. If you’re going with a bunch, reserving early helps make sure you get the best room dimension and time slot.
When booking, ask about charges, cancellation guidelines, and whether or not food or drinks are included. Knowing these particulars in advance helps you avoid surprises when the bill arrives.
Plan Your Songs Ahead of Time
A little song preparation can make your karaoke evening much more enjoyable. Instead of scrolling through hundreds of options once you arrive, think about a few songs in advance. Choose tracks that match your vocal comfort level and the mood of the group. A mixture of crowd-pleasing hits, nostalgic favorites, and straightforward sing-along songs often works well.
It is usually useful to organize backup choices. Typically a music will not be available, or someone else might already have selected it. Having two or three options ready keeps things easy and reduces stage nerves.

Arrive Early and Understand the Setup
Getting to the karaoke bar early has a number of benefits. You can check in without rushing, get acquainted with the music request system, and settle into the environment before the group builds. If the venue uses digital music selection, tablets, or paper slips, take a moment to understand how everything works.
Arriving early additionally offers you an opportunity to secure good seating, order your first drink or snack, and ease into the night. If you’re nervous about singing, this extra time may also help you calm down and build confidence earlier than your turn.
Know Primary Karaoke Etiquette
Great karaoke nights depend on positive energy and respect for others. Cheer for different singers, avoid interrupting performances, and keep the atmosphere supportive. Even if someone will not be the strongest singer, enthusiasm matters more than perfection in karaoke culture.
You also needs to keep away from dominating the song queue. Give everybody in your group a chance to participate. If you’re going with friends, encourage shy individuals without forcing them. Karaoke is meant to be enjoyable, not stressful.
